This allows us to do things like:
```
local fp = assert(fbsd.exec({"ls", "-l"}, true))
local fpout = assert(fp:stdout())
while true do
local line = fpout:read("l")
if not line then break end
print("Read: " .. line)
end
fp:close()
```
The makeman lua rewrite will use it to capture `make showconfig` output
for processing.
